How to decode a 2020 Mitsubishi RVR VIN

Characters 1-3 of a 2020 Mitsubishi RVR VIN

A World Manufacturer Identifier (WMI) is a unique code assigned to each vehicle manufacturer to identify the origin, manufacturer, and type of motor vehicle. In the case of the 2020 Mitsubishi RVR, this code indicates that it is a model by Mitsubishi Motors Corporation, based in Minato-Ku, Tokyo, Japan. Specifically, the WMI reveals that the vehicle is a Multipurpose Passenger Vehicle (MPV), which encompasses SUVs and similar vehicles. Manufactured in Japan, the RVR for these model years falls under this classification, catering to the needs of those seeking a versatile and reliable vehicle. The WMI serves as a crucial first set of characters in a vehicle’s VIN (Vehicle Identification Number), ensuring a globally recognizable and standardized identifier for vehicles.

Character 9 is the “check digit” in a 2020 Mitsubishi RVR VIN.

Based on a formula developed by the US Department of Transportation, it helps reduce fraud by ensuring the validity of the VIN.

How to find a 2020 Mitsubishi RVR’s VIN?

Locating the VIN number on your 2020 Mitsubishi RVR is key for identification. Here’s how to find it:

  1. Look at the dashboard on the driver’s side of your Mitsubishi RVR 2020. The VIN is frequently visible through the windshield on a small metal or plastic plate.
  2. Open the driver’s side door and check the door jamb or the door post (where the door latches when it is closed) for a sticker that may contain the VIN.
  3. Examine the engine block for the Mitsubishi RVR 2020, as the VIN is sometimes stamped onto the engine itself.
  4. Look inside the vehicle where the dashboard meets the windshield on the passenger’s side for the VIN.
  5. Check the vehicle’s registration documents or the insurance policy, as they will have the VIN listed for your Mitsubishi RVR 2020.
